Planning is a must - Damien Lovegrove tells us why having a plan when shooting a wedding is a very good idea.
The Lovegroves burst onto the wedding photography scene in 2000 and it took them just two years to reach the top of their game. Here's his tip:
"Plan each wedding day thoroughly. Julie and I plan our involvement in every detail of each wedding schedule like a military operation. Why? Firstly, because we want to achieve high standards we need to use our time efficiently and secondly, because we don't want anything to take us by surprise. So instead of waiting for problems to happen, we try to identify and rectify them as early as possible."
